随着科技的飞速发展,人工智能(AI)技术的应用范围越来越广泛,其中就包括了游戏开发的领域。人工智能不仅为游戏开发者提供了强大的工具和资源,而且也深刻地影响了游戏的创作过程和最终产品的用户体验。本文将深入探讨人工智能技术如何应用于游戏开发,以及它所带来的创新与变革。
首先,让我们看看人工智能是如何影响游戏设计的。传统的游戏设计往往依赖于设计师的经验和对玩家的预判,而人工智能则可以通过大数据分析来更准确地理解玩家行为模式。例如,通过机器学习算法,游戏可以动态调整难度级别以适应不同水平的玩家,确保每个玩家都能享受到最佳的游戏体验。此外,人工智能还可以帮助设计团队生成大量独特的关卡或角色,从而增加游戏的多样性。
其次,人工智能在游戏中扮演着重要的角色,它可以增强游戏的交互性和沉浸感。虚拟助手和智能 NPC 可以根据玩家的选择和行动做出实时反应,使得游戏世界更加生动真实。例如,《底特律:变人》这款互动电影式游戏中,玩家做出的决策会直接影响到剧情的发展,这种高度个性化且具有分支性的故事线,正是得益于人工智能的技术支持。
再者,人工智能可以帮助优化游戏开发流程。从早期的概念艺术到后期的测试阶段,AI 都可以发挥作用。例如,利用计算机视觉技术,可以快速识别并修复图形错误;而在 QA 测试过程中,自动化脚本可以执行大量的重复性任务,如压力测试和性能评估等。这些都极大地提高了工作效率,节省了宝贵的时间和资源。
最后,我们不能忽视人工智能对于未来游戏行业发展的潜在影响。随着深度学习和强化学习的不断进步,我们可以期待看到更多具有自适应能力的游戏系统,它们能够根据玩家的反馈和学习数据进行自我进化。这可能会带来全新的游戏类型,甚至可能改变我们对于“什么是游戏”的传统认知。
综上所述,人工智能技术正在重塑游戏开发的各个环节,从设计到发布再到运营维护,无处不在的影响着我们熟悉的游戏世界。虽然目前还存在一些挑战,比如伦理问题和技术瓶颈,但随着研究的深入和发展,我们有理由相信,人工智能将在未来的游戏中发挥更为关键的作用,为我们创造出更加丰富多彩的游戏体验。